SPI SONOGRAPHY PRINCIPLES AND
INSTRUMENTATION BUNDLE 2026
COMPLETE QUESTIONS AND
VERIFIED ANSWERS

◉ Unrelated. Answer: Not associated or connected


◉ Directly Related or Proportional. Answer: 2 or more items associated
AND connected; (1 item ↑, the other ↑)


◉ Intensity. Answer: Intensity is proportional to Power. Intensity AND
Power are proportional to Amplitude2


◉ Inversely Related. Answer: 2 or more items associated AND
connected; (1 item ↑, the other ↓)


◉ Period & Frequency. Answer: Period & Frequency are inversely
related. Period ↑ Frequency ↓


◉ Reciprocal. Answer: 2 numbers multiplied (x) the result (=) is one
(↿) *Reciprocals are also inversely related; 1 item ↑, the other ↓*


◉ Sound Waves. Answer: All waves carry energy from one location to
another. Sound is a mechanical wave

,◉ Medium for Sound. Answer: Sound cannot travel through vacuum;
MUST travel through a medium


◉ Sound Wave Direction. Answer: Sound travels in a straight line


◉ Longitudinal Waves. Answer: Sound waves are longitudinal


◉ Acoustic Waves. Answer: Sound waves are also referred to as
acoustic waves


◉ Acoustic Variables. Answer: [ Pressure, Density, & Distance ] Used
to distinguish between sound waves and other types of waves


◉ Pressure. Answer: Concentration of force in an area measured in
Pascals (Pa)


◉ Density. Answer: Concentration of mass in a volume measured in
kg/cm3


◉ Distance (particle motion). Answer: Measure of particle motion
measured in cm, ft, mile


◉ Acoustic Parameters. Answer: There are seven acoustic parameters

,◉ Period. Answer: Time from the start of one cycle, to the start of the
next cycle measured in microseconds (μs)


◉ Frequency. Answer: Number of cycles that occurs in 1 second
measured in Hertz (Hz) 'per second'


◉ Amplitude. Answer: Difference between the minimum value & the
average value of the acoustic variable


◉ Power. Answer: Rate of energy transfer measured in Watts (W)


◉ Wavelength. Answer: Distance or length of one complete cycle
measured in mm, meters, any unit of length


◉ Propagation Speed. Answer: Rate at which a sound wave travels
through a medium measured in m/s, mm/μs


◉ Wavelength Formula. Answer: wavelength = 1.54 mm/μs


◉ Sound Speed Order. Answer: Sound travels fastest in solids, slower in
liquids, & slowest in gases. Order from fastest →slowest: Bone
→Tendon →Muscle →Blood →Liver


◉ Stiffness. Answer: Ability of an object to resist compression

, ◉ Density & Speed Relationship. Answer: Density & speed are
inversely related


◉ Bulk Modulus. Answer: Bulk Modulus is the same as stiffness


◉ Speed Determinants. Answer: Speed is determined by the density &
stiffness of the medium


◉ Speed Increase with Stiffness. Answer: If stiffness increases ↑, speed
increases ↑


◉ Speed Decrease with Density. Answer: If density increases ↑, speed
decreases ↓


◉ Speed Formula. Answer: Speed = Frequency (Hz) x Wavelength (m)


◉ Pulsed Waves. Answer: Pulsed ultrasound has 2 components:
Transmit, talking, or 'on' time and Receive, listening, or 'off' time


◉ Pulsed Duration. Answer: Actual time from the start of a pulse, to the
end of a pulse


◉ Pulse Repetition Period (PRP). Answer: Time from the start of one
pulse, to the start of the next pulse
